Java SQLException:一般错误

Java SQLException:一般错误,java,sql,jtable,Java,Sql,Jtable,我得到java.sql.SQLException:General error 我试图从Access数据库中删除数据,但它抛出了该错误。 试一试{ 数据库中的数据完美地插入到了JTable中,我使用了JOptionPane.showMessageDialogs来检查数组是否为null,但数组中填充了值 我试图删除一个值,但仍然得到相同的错误 Exception in thread "AWT-EventQueue-0" java.lang.RuntimeException: java.sql.SQL

我得到
java.sql.SQLException:General error
我试图从Access数据库中删除数据,但它抛出了该错误。 试一试{

数据库中的数据完美地插入到了JTable中,我使用了JOptionPane.showMessageDialogs来检查数组是否为null,但数组中填充了值

我试图删除一个值,但仍然得到相同的错误

Exception in thread "AWT-EventQueue-0" java.lang.RuntimeException: java.sql.SQLException: General error
    Caused by: java.sql.SQLException: General error
    at sun.jdbc.odbc.JdbcOdbc.createSQLException(Unknown Source)
    at sun.jdbc.odbc.JdbcOdbc.standardError(Unknown Source)
    at sun.jdbc.odbc.JdbcOdbc.SQLExecute(Unknown Source)
    at sun.jdbc.odbc.JdbcOdbcPreparedStatement.execute(Unknown Source)
    at sun.jdbc.odbc.JdbcOdbcPreparedStatement.executeQuery(Unknown Source)
    at Main$ButtonEditor.getCellEditorValue(Main.java:442)

对数据库写入操作使用
executeUpdate

pst.executeUpdate();

您的查询在语法上看起来不正确,不应该是
从表1中删除,其中name=?和level=?…
我确实从表1中删除了
其中name=value
,但它仍然会得到相同的错误`尝试直接在Access中运行查询,以查看查询是否有效我猜Access有错误…只是尝试了Access中的所有操作都很好,just启动了代码,它工作了…该语句看起来根本不像SQL。除非这是一些有效的访问特定语法,否则我会开始在那里搜索问题。默认的
DELETE FROM table 1,其中name=value
仍然会给我相同的错误,这只是问题的一部分。我不确定
1pn
是否是一个错误gal标识符,而p-d几乎肯定不是。
pst.executeUpdate();